Distribution, Warehouse & Postroom Operative Norfolk, PE31 6RH

Keep our organisation moving with an efficient, reliable service.

Join CITB as a Distribution, Warehouse & Postroom Operative and play a vital role in ensuring mail, parcels, deliveries and internal documents are received, processed and distributed accurately across the organisation. Working as part of the Estates team, you'll provide a reliable, customer-focused service while maintaining high standards of security, efficiency and professionalism.

What you'll do
  • Receive, sort, process and distribute incoming and outgoing mail, parcels and deliveries.
  • Arrange courier services and process recorded, registered and special delivery items.
  • Operate franking, postage, scanning and mail tracking systems, maintaining accurate records.
  • Provide excellent customer service, responding to enquiries and resolving routine issues.
  • Assist with stock control and ordering of postal and packaging supplies.
  • Handle confidential information securely and in line with data protection requirements.
  • Support the wider Estates team and contribute to continuous service improvements.
  • Follow health and safety procedures, including manual handling and secure storage of deliveries.
What you'll bring
  • Strong organisational and time management skills with the ability to work to deadlines.
  • Good digital skills, including Microsoft Office, printers and scanners.
  • A valid UK driving licence.
  • Excellent communication and customer service skills.
  • Accurate administration and record-keeping abilities.
  • Ability to safely carry out manual handling tasks.
  • Warehouse, distribution or logistics experience.
  • Telehandler CPCS qualification, or willingness to achieve this within six months.
  • Understanding of health, safety and environmental standards.
